在Vue中实现点击菜单项自动跳转到对应页面是一个常见的功能,这可以通过Vue Router来实现。Vue Router是Vue.js的官方路由管理器,它允许你为单页面应用定义路由和嵌套路由,从而控制页面的切换。以下是如何使用Vue Router实现点击菜单项自动跳转到对应页面的步骤:
1. 安装Vue Router:首先,确保你的项目中已经安装了Vue Router。如果没有,你可以通过npm或yarn来安装它。
2. 创建路由定义:在Vue项目中,创建一个名为`router.js`的文件来定义路由。例如:
3. 将路由注入Vue实例:在主Vue实例中,将创建的路由实例注入:
4. 创建菜单组件:在Vue组件中,创建一个菜单组件,它将包含指向不同路由的菜单项。例如:
在这里,我们使用了`<router-link>`组件来创建可点击的菜单项。当点击这些链接时,Vue Router会自动更新视图,并导航到对应的路由。
5. 使用路由视图:在主应用组件中,使用`<router-view>`组件来显示当前路由对应的组件:
通过以上步骤,你就可以实现点击菜单项后自动跳转到对应页面的功能了。Vue Router会处理所有与路由相关的逻辑,包括页面切换和URL更新,使得用户体验更加流畅和一致。